Subject: Quickstore 4.2 — bloom filter now fronts the KV layer

Plugin authors: starting with this release, Quickstore places a bloom filter ahead of the key-value store. Negative lookups return faster; false positives fall through safely. No API changes are required on your side. Verify your plugin against the staging build referenced below.

session token of fahif-tadup = htk3_9c7

Q3 Planning Note — Sales Leads

Project Midlane, the internal quoting-tool rebuild, has slipped to late Q4 due to data-migration issues. Continue using the legacy Penfold system for now; pricing updates will ship manually each Monday. Territory targets are unchanged. The confidential note on the revised rollout plan appears directly below.

internal memo for yahag-tahog: The pricing group signed off on a budget of $152.8 million for Project Soriel.

Migration step 4 — Quillgate autoscaler. Drain the old worker pool before enabling the queue-depth autoscaler, or scaling decisions will double-count consumers. Flip the feature flag only after queue lag drops under the threshold. Rollback is the same flag; no data risk. Metrics land under the scaler namespace within two minutes. Apply the following configuration values to the staging scaler first.

config for kafof-bawef:
holath:
  log_level: debug
  metrics_host: metrics.holath.qorvelsys.internal
  pin: 2191
  pool_size: 32

## Idempotency Keys for Payment Retries (Lumopay)

Every retry of a charge request must reuse the original idempotency key; generating a new key on retry can produce duplicate charges. Keys are scoped per merchant and expire after 48 hours. Reviewers should verify keys are derived server-side, never from client input. The full key-generation specification and threat model are maintained on the internal page.

dashboard of kaguf-tawip = https://vault.merlaqsys.test/issue